Village girl Marisha loves coachman Jacob. The father of Mariska, a wealthy peasant, does not agree to marry his daughter with a coachman. Soon Mariska has a child. Harassed by villagers, Marisha rushes with her son into the river. close

Years of recovery. A merchant kulak kept peasants in bondage in one of the villages. The poor co-operator-led co-operatives tried in vain to fight the kulak. A demobilized Red Army soldier returned to the village. Relying on the help of peasants and Selkor, he established cooperative trade and completely ousted the kulaks. The victory of cooperation caused an increase in the economic well-being of the village: a power station was built, a cinema was opened. close

A young Ukrainian Ostap Bandura learns from his grandfather about the brutal massacre committed in the pre-reform years by the landowner-serf over Ostap’s grandmother. The story intensifies in Ostap, who serves as a coachman on the estate of General Kornyagin, a feeling of hatred for landowners. And when the general's daughter Julia makes an attempt to seduce the young coachman, Ostap in anger kills her. The coachman is sentenced to prison. In prison, he meets with political prisoners and begins to realize that the liberation of the peasants can only happen as a result of revolution. . . close
